Amy K. Burkoth is a scholar working on Organic Chemistry, Surgery and Orthodontics. According to data from OpenAlex, Amy K. Burkoth has authored 6 papers receiving a total of 441 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Organic Chemistry, 2 papers in Surgery and 2 papers in Orthodontics. Recurrent topics in Amy K. Burkoth's work include Dental materials and restorations (2 papers), Orthopaedic implants and arthroplasty (2 papers) and Bone Tissue Engineering Materials (2 papers). Amy K. Burkoth is often cited by papers focused on Dental materials and restorations (2 papers), Orthopaedic implants and arthroplasty (2 papers) and Bone Tissue Engineering Materials (2 papers). Amy K. Burkoth collaborates with scholars based in United States. Amy K. Burkoth's co-authors include Kristi S. Anseth, Jason A. Burdick and Hyun‐Ro Lee and has published in prestigious journals such as Biomaterials, Macromolecules and Journal of Biomedical Materials Research.
